Output 3139860f7e22d2608f371b71c4fdb86585f2c244b0d5b0abc6a6821dc6150bbc:1

value
384647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 124fd9fcd6b34c7a373b892154d72dda7cba50e3 OP_EQUAL
address
33MqkBEHJ1U3g78yUgmyNkjkhDLXuGZPma
transaction
3139860f7e22d2608f371b71c4fdb86585f2c244b0d5b0abc6a6821dc6150bbc
confirmations
373259
spent
true